Äännähdät
Äännähdät is a Finnish term that refers to the sounds or utterances made by humans or animals. It encompasses a broad range of vocalizations, from simple noises to more complex speech. In the context of human language, äännähdät can refer to the basic phonetic elements of speech, such as vowels and consonants, as well as the prosodic features like intonation and stress. These sounds are the building blocks of words and sentences, and their precise articulation is crucial for effective communication.
